German

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ɡəˈʃɪk/
  • Hyphenation: Ge‧schick

Etymology 1

From (deprecated template usage) [etyl] Middle High German geschicke (occurrence, incident; disposition).

Noun

Geschick n (genitive Geschickes or Geschicks, plural Geschicke)

  1. (formal) destiny, fate
  2. the political and economic situation or development; living conditions

Etymology 2

Related to geschickt (adept, skillful).

Noun

Geschick n (genitive Geschickes or Geschicks, no plural)

  1. deftness, skill, ability
  2. (regional) order
